The Newborn Infant
At 43 weeks’ gestation, a long, thin infant is delivered. The infant is apneic, limp, pale, and covered with “pea soup” amniotic fluid. The first step in the resuscitation of this infant at delivery should be
Suction of the trachea under direct vision
Artificial ventilation with bag and mask
Artificial ventilation with endotracheal tube
Administration of 100% oxygen by mask
